Distribution

The surname Morfea has a relatively low incidence rate in various countries around the world. According to data collected from several countries, the surname Morfea is most commonly found in Italy, with an incidence rate of 74. This suggests that the surname has a strong presence in Italian culture and history. The surname Morfea is also found in other countries such as Australia, the United States, Canada, and Switzerland, although with lower incidence rates ranging from 1 to 48.
